Digging into the top line a bit more:


Huberdeau-Lindholm-Toffoli: 1.13 Goals/60, 42% GF%

Lindholm-Toffoli (no Huberdeau): 4.22 Goals/60, 60% GF%

Huberdeau (no Lindholm or Toffoli): 2.39 Goals/60, 71% GF%


They're all better with the line split up.
